How they compare
Sweden currently reports 24.3% against 22.7% in Lebanon, a difference of 1.6%.
That makes Sweden's figure about 1.1 times Lebanon's.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 33 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Lebanon ahead.
Lebanon ranks 38th and Sweden ranks 35th of 186 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Lebanon averaged higher in 3 and Sweden in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Lebanon | Sweden |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 20.5% | 17.8% | 2.7% | Lebanon |
| 2000s | 20.0% | 17.6% | 2.4% | Lebanon |
| 2010s | 20.0% | 21.2% | 1.2% | Sweden |
| 2020s | 24.4% | 23.0% | 1.4% | Lebanon |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
